  • Title

    A 1.5V 45mW direct conversion WCDMA receiver IC in 0.13/spl mu/m CMOS

  • Abstract
    A complete WCDMA receiver IC is integrated in 0.13/spl mu/m CMOS. Circuit features include: 1.5V operation, high compression in FDD mode, base-band filter/AGC gain accuracy (70dB/spl plusmn/0.2dB), cutoff frequency accuracy (/spl plusmn/1.5%) and low output offset (<20mV). Overall NF is 6.5dB, IIP3 = -9dBm, IIP2 = 27dBm and power consumption is 45mW.
